in the Yom Kippur war, I don't think the goal of the Arabs was to actually conquer Israel... it was more to retake the territory they had lost in the '67 war. It would have been more of an embarassment to Israel rather than death... and they still would have held onto the West Bank, since Jordan was minimally involved...
